What is Dynamic Simulation?

Dynamic simulation is a computational technique used to model the behavior of complex systems as they evolve over time. It involves representing a system with mathematical equations and logical rules, then executing these models to observe and predict system responses to various inputs and conditions.

This method allows for the exploration of how interdependencies within a system change dynamically, providing insights into performance, bottlenecks, and potential outcomes. It is particularly valuable when analytical solutions are intractable due to system complexity or stochastic elements.

The application of dynamic simulation spans numerous fields, from engineering and manufacturing to finance and biological systems. It helps decision-makers test hypotheses, optimize processes, and mitigate risks in a virtual environment before implementing changes in the real world.

Understanding Dynamic Simulation

Dynamic simulation involves creating a virtual representation of a real-world system to observe its reactions to various stimuli over a defined period. This process utilizes algorithms and computational power to mimic the system’s internal logic and external interactions.

The core principle is to break down a complex system into smaller, interconnected components. Each component is assigned specific rules and parameters that govern its behavior and interaction with other parts of the system. Time is advanced in discrete steps or continuously, and the state of the system is updated at each interval based on these rules.

Unlike static models that provide a snapshot at a single point, dynamic simulations illustrate evolution and change. This allows for the identification of trends, oscillations, and stability characteristics that might not be apparent from static analyses. For instance, simulating a manufacturing line can reveal how capacity management affects throughput during peak demand.

The process typically begins with problem definition and data collection, followed by model construction and validation. Once a model is deemed representative, it is used for experimentation and analysis. This iterative approach ensures the model accurately reflects reality and produces reliable predictions.

Formula

Dynamic simulation does not adhere to a single universal formula, as it is a methodology rather than a specific equation. Instead, it relies on a system of interconnected mathematical equations, logical rules, and probabilistic distributions that represent the system being modeled.
